Responsibilities:
Prepare full vehicle CAE models using HYPERMESH/ANSA : Meshing, connection, assembly, constraints & load setting for automotive BIW and its sub-systems.
- Full vehicle NVH simulation using NASTRAN/ACTRAN
- Interpretation of results, comprehending failure modes shapes and providing directions for countermeasures.
- Report preparation: Communication with design and testing for implementation of countermeasures.
- Interact with testing teams for analyzing failures, correlation of CAE results with physical testing results and improvement in CAE methodology.
Application of Artificial Intelligent/Machine Learning in the NVH CAE
Technical/ Functional
:
- Must have knowledge of automotive noise and vibration.
- Must have knowledge of CAE & Meshing using Hypermesh.
- Good understanding of complete Transfer path for Road Noise/Power Train Noise including Suspension components.
- Positive understanding of automotive sheet metal & plastic part design.
- Debug the CAE model/ Nastran error independently.
- Should have experience of working with NVH CAE engineers and making design modifications based on CAE inputs.
- Candidate having “exposure to physical test procedure & ability to understand physical NVH test result” will be preferred.
- The ability to suggest effective countermeasures for performance improvement is desired.
Exposure to NVH related vehicle design aspect is desired.
